How to change computing curricula to produce socially responsible ethical, computing professionals?
Computing for the Social Good in Education (CSG-Ed) deals with methods for producing computing graduates who are focused on using their computing education towards the benefit of society. We invite participants to discuss how they would reimagine their institution’s and general computing curriculum, if they were supreme, magic wand wielding, curricular overlords.
We give you a magic wand; what does your new computing curriculum look like?
This free and open to all, SIGCAS-sponsored affiliated event (https://www.sigcas.org/csged/) will explore this question through prepared presentations, group activities, and the sharing of proposals among the participants and hopefully the larger computing education community. Our shared intent is to shape the next generation of computing curricula, such as the upcoming Computer Science Curricula 202X report (https://csed.hosting.acm.org/).
